Developmental tasks are the asks that individuals have to learn throughout their lives. It is important to successfully achieve certain tasks, because it is expected to lead to happiness and to success with later tasks.
The five developmental tasks of young adulthood are: Becoming more self-sufficient, preparing for a job or career, becoming socially responsible, learning to get along with friends of both sexes, accepting one's physical body and keeping it healthy.The accomplishing of one task influences the accomplishing of another one. For example if the individual learn to get along with friends she/he will become socially responsible.
